ROAG 
ROAG, shortened for Race Organisers Admin Group, administrates and streamlines small sporting events through an online data management system. Situated in Pietermaritzburg, they offer a substantial range of administrative & marketing services to event organisers who require assistance with various aspects of running a sporting event such as seeding & batching structures, online entries, late entries, manual entries, a call centre, facilitating timing and a variety of marketing services. The event organiser essentially outsources the administration of their event to ROAG, who has a well-established and specialised sports event admin system. They also provide their members with access to a portal/website that incorporates events-related news, info, results, seeding indexes, calendars, an entry system and an interactive profile along with many other services. ROAG registration is FREE and they currently have over 50 000 ROAG members. They’re also on Facebook and on Twitter.

PaarlMTB
PaarlMTB is a website that lists Paarl’s Mountain Biking communities. They give suggestions of routes, listed riders and their ranks, a free notice board, classifieds and local bike shops in Paarl. They also announce upcoming events on their Facebook and Twitter pages.
